In docs - https://dbeaver.com/docs/cloudbeaver/Query-manager-database-configuration/ I saw that it's possible to use H2 db for QM in community editon..
When I set QM settings in the main server configuration and run some SQL queries nothing happens - no logs, no data in H2 db connected with QM.
What it's the purpose of setting QM in community edition when it's doing nothing?
